Synopsis of Specimen Days
En 'Specimen Days', Michael Cunningham entrelaza tres historias ambientadas en diferentes épocas de la historia de Nueva York. Desde la Revolución Industrial hasta un futuro distópico, los personajes se enfrentan a desafíos y transformaciones en una ciudad en constante evolución. Con una prosa evocadora y una narrativa cautivadora, Cunningham explora temas de progreso, decadencia y la búsqueda de significado en un mundo en cambio.

Michael Cunningham
Michael Cunningham is an American novelist and screenwriter. He is best known for his 1998 novel The Hours, which won the Pulitzer Prize for Fiction and the PEN/Faulkner Award in 1999. Cunningham is Professor in the Practice of Creative Writing at Yale University.
